About Jennifer Lapin

Professional Statement

Dr. Jennifer Lapen is part of the developmental pediatrics team at Dayton Children’s, supporting children with developmental, behavioral and learning differences. They partner with families to create care plans that help each child reach their full potential. Dr. Lapin is a graduate of University of Texas Medical Branch. She is board certified in pediatrics and specializes in Down syndrome.
